The Raptors have recalled two-way player Oshae Brissett from the G-League.

have recalled two-way player Oshae Brissett from their G League affiliate, Raptors 905.

Brissett spent time with the parent club during NBA pre-season as well as with the Canadian men’s national team last summer. With the Raptors dealing with substantial losses across the roster , Brissett will serve as depth at the forward position. NBA teams are allowed to have their two-way players join up with the parent club for a maximum of 45 days over the course of the 82-game campaign.

In the first and only game Raptors 905 has played so far this season, Brissett scored 14 points, had six rebounds, and recorded two blocks in 27.4 minutes against the Grand Rapids Drive.
